UR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ID1
Нить номер: 92682
[ Назад ]

Исходное сообщение
"Рандомное зависание сервера "

Отправлено kbu , 30-Ноя-11 23:49 
Помогите пожалуйста понять в чем проблема и разрулить ее... Сервер на базе Ubuntu 11.04, LAMP,pptpd,ftp.в начале периодически начал отваливатся Apache но при этом phpmyadmin работал..но при подключении по ssh и попытке ввести какую - нибудь комманду, консоль больше не отвечала...в логах ничего подозрительного обнаружено небыло.а вот сегодня сервер как я понял повис вообще...скрин https://picasaweb.google.com/108860862466016490702/qeSppG#56....

Прошу помочь...


Содержание

Сообщения в этом обсуждении
"Рандомное зависание сервера "
Отправлено me , 01-Дек-11 10:02 
а вот сегодня сервер как я понял повис вообще...скрин https://picasaweb.google.com/108860862466016490702/qeSppG#56....

свапит он у вас не по деццки, sysstat какой-нть заведите, что-б убедиться


"Рандомное зависание сервера "
Отправлено kbu , 01-Дек-11 12:59 
> а вот сегодня сервер как я понял повис вообще...скрин https://picasaweb.google.com/108860862466016490702/qeSppG#56....
> свапит он у вас не по деццки, sysstat какой-нть заведите, что-б убедиться

Подскажите пожалуйста, как правильней и корректней это исправить?


"Рандомное зависание сервера "
Отправлено Дядя_Федор , 01-Дек-11 14:32 
> Подскажите пожалуйста, как правильней и корректней это исправить?

Оперативы добавить, смею предположить?



"Рандомное зависание сервера "
Отправлено kbu , 01-Дек-11 15:37 
>> Подскажите пожалуйста, как правильней и корректней это исправить?
>  Оперативы добавить, смею предположить?

на сервере в данный момент 4ГБ,мало?


"Рандомное зависание сервера "
Отправлено Дядя_Федор , 01-Дек-11 17:20 
> на сервере в данный момент 4ГБ,мало?

Выше речь шла об активном свопинге. Если это так - то мало.



"Рандомное зависание сервера "
Отправлено kbu , 01-Дек-11 17:24 
>> на сервере в данный момент 4ГБ,мало?
>  Выше речь шла об активном свопинге. Если это так - то
> мало.

Хорошо, что можно сделать без добавления оперативы? Какие есть варианты?


"Рандомное зависание сервера "
Отправлено BullDog , 01-Дек-11 18:36 
> Хорошо, что можно сделать без добавления оперативы? Какие есть варианты?

Можно вот тут почитать сначала и понять как лимитировать overcommit - http://catap.ru/blog/2009/05/03/about-memory-oom-killer/

За счет этого можно добиться того, что свопить будет "мало" и соответственно останется "отзывчивым". Как следствие можно поиметь вылеты, ошибки и т.д. софта как следствие недостатка памяти... Ну тут уж надо дальше (и глубже) смотреть у кого проблемы, можно ли потюнить его, сколько ему реально надо памяти и т.д...


"Рандомное зависание сервера "
Отправлено kbu , 01-Дек-11 18:46 
>> Хорошо, что можно сделать без добавления оперативы? Какие есть варианты?
> Можно вот тут почитать сначала и понять как лимитировать overcommit - http://catap.ru/blog/2009/05/03/about-memory-oom-killer/
> За счет этого можно добиться того, что свопить будет "мало" и соответственно
> останется "отзывчивым". Как следствие можно поиметь вылеты, ошибки и т.д. софта
> как следствие недостатка памяти... Ну тут уж надо дальше (и глубже)
> смотреть у кого проблемы, можно ли потюнить его, сколько ему реально
> надо памяти и т.д...

Большое спасибо за ссылочку и за совет!


"Рандомное зависание сервера "
Отправлено Дядя_Федор , 01-Дек-11 22:26 
> Хорошо, что можно сделать без добавления оперативы? Какие есть варианты?

До кучи - есть еще такой параметр, связанный со своппингом в sysctl - vm_swapiness. Суть его - агрессивность свопинга. Почитайте о нем вот тут - http://poige.livejournal.com/350067.html Ну и тут - http://ru.gentoo-wiki.com/wiki/%D0%AF%D0%... А вообще надо смотреть, чем прогружена система.
За ссылку про OOM Killer - тоже спасибо. Почитаю завтра, довольно полезная статейка. :)



"Рандомное зависание сервера "
Отправлено kbu , 01-Дек-11 23:02 
спасибо!почитаю!